Broader Legal Context and Capital Punishment Statutes
The demand for capital punishment underscores ongoing national conversations regarding the application of the death penalty in high-profile criminal litigation. Legal scholars observe that capital cases impose extraordinarily high evidentiary standards, requiring bifurcated trial phases where guilt and sentencing are determined through separate, rigorous evidentiary evaluations by an empaneled jury.
Furthermore, capital litigation mandates extensive post-conviction appellate avenues, frequently extending judicial review across multiple appellate levels for several years. State judicial administration records demonstrate that cases involving potential execution involve rigorous pre-trial discovery motions, extensive mitigating factor analyses, and heightened requirements for jury death qualification prior to formal trial opening statements.
